Visit the
Passport Center

U.S. citizens currently need a passport for any air travel abroad, and by June 1, 2009 they'll need one for most land and sea travel as well. Visit our very practical Passport Center and learn how to get your first passport, protect your travel documents from theft, renew your passport and more.
